So who delivers the fastest speeds in Corpus Christi? Based on Speedtest data collected in the second half of 2025, AT&T Fiber leads the city with median downloads of 421.28 Mbps, followed by Spectrum at 375.98 Mbps. Across Corpus Christi overall, typical fixed connections average 372.82 Mbps down, enough for remote work, streaming, and everyday multitasking across multiple devices.

Choosing the right speed tier comes down to how your household uses the internet. Most families do well with 300 to 500 Mbps for simultaneous streaming, video calls, and browsing. Larger households or those with heavy upload needs—like creators or remote professionals—should consider gigabit fiber plans.

How to Pick the Right Internet Provider in Corpus Christi

Here are some practical tips:

Check Your Address
Many ISPs tout citywide coverage, but availability varies block by block. Use provider lookup tools or Speedtest's zip code breakdowns to verify what's actually available at your address.

Consider More Than Speed
Reliability, customer support, and data caps matter just as much as raw speed. Many fiber plans include unlimited data and no equipment rental fees, while some cable plans have data caps that could affect heavy users.

Think About Uploads
If you regularly send large files, stream on Twitch, or make frequent video calls, symmetrical upload/download speeds (typically only offered by fiber) can make a significant difference in your daily experience.

Match a Plan to Your Needs
Don't pay for gigabit if you're just browsing and streaming a few hours a night. On the flip side, don't go too cheap if you're running a business or have multiple heavy users at home.

Read the Fine Print
Promotional rates often expire after 12 months. Check for hidden fees, contracts, or equipment rentals that could inflate your total cost over time.

ISP Speeds in Corpus Christi, TX

According to Speedtest Intelligence®, as of January 2026, Corpus Christi reports the following city-wide median speeds:

MetricResult
Median download speed372.82 Mbps
Median upload speed39.52 Mbps
Median latency21 ms
Top-performing ISPAT&T Fiber (421.28 Mbps median download)

ISP Speeds in Corpus Christi, Texas

Based on Speedtest data collected in the second half of 2025, here's how the major providers compare:

  • AT&T Fiber: Corpus Christi's fastest provider based on real-world performance. Downloads of 421.28 Mbps, uploads of 347.75 Mbps. Its fiber infrastructure delivers symmetrical speeds ideal for video calls, cloud backups, and content creation.
  • Spectrum: A strong performer in the Corpus Christi market. Downloads of 375.98 Mbps, uploads of 22.31 Mbps. Its cable network provides solid download performance for streaming and everyday browsing.
  • Astound Broadband powered by Wave: Available in parts of Corpus Christi. Downloads of 294.48 Mbps, uploads of 36.83 Mbps.
  • T-Mobile 5G Home Internet: Available in Corpus Christi. Real-world Speedtest data is not yet available for this market. It offers flexible, contract-free wireless service with quick setup.
  • Starlink: Available in Corpus Christi. Real-world Speedtest data is not yet available for this market. It provides satellite coverage for areas where wired options may be limited.
  • Verizon: Available in Corpus Christi. Real-world Speedtest data is not yet available for this market. It offers flexible, contract-free wireless service with quick setup.
  • GTEK Communications: Available in Corpus Christi. Real-world Speedtest data is not yet available for this market.

Home Internet in Corpus Christi

At the time of this writing, the average starting price for internet in Corpus Christi is about $49 per month, based on entry-level plans from major providers in the area. Wireless providers typically offer plans around $50 to $70. Most households can expect to pay between $50 to $85 per month for reliable service.

Top Internet Providers in Corpus Christi, Texas

AT&T Fiber

  • Type: Fiber
  • Max speeds: Up to 2000 Mbps download / 1000 Mbps upload
  • Best for: Remote workers, creators, and large households
  • Price range: $55–$180/month

Based on Speedtest data collected in the second half of 2025, AT&T Fiber delivers median download speeds of 421.28 Mbps and upload speeds of 347.75 Mbps in Corpus Christi. Its symmetrical speeds make it well-suited for video conferencing, cloud storage, and content creation.

Spectrum

  • Type: Cable
  • Max speeds: Up to 1200 Mbps download / 35 Mbps upload
  • Best for: General households with moderate to heavy usage
  • Price range: $55–$150/month

Based on Speedtest data collected in the second half of 2025, Spectrum delivers median download speeds of 375.98 Mbps and upload speeds of 22.31 Mbps in Corpus Christi. Its cable infrastructure provides solid download performance for streaming and general browsing.

Astound Broadband powered by Wave

  • Type: Internet
  • Max speeds: Up to 1000 Mbps download / 50 Mbps upload
  • Best for: General households with moderate to heavy usage
  • Price range: $50–$80/month

Based on Speedtest data collected in the second half of 2025, Astound Broadband powered by Wave delivers median download speeds of 294.48 Mbps and upload speeds of 36.83 Mbps in Corpus Christi.
